The rock carefully focused on being just [Like a Rock], making sure the dragon would not notice anything strange about it. After all, it was just your average rock. What could be strange about such a thing?

So the dragon did not notice anything strange, and just nodded approvingly at the Gneiss decoration it would have for its brand-new lair. A proper centerpiece for its display. And so, it began decorating.

And how would a dragon decorate a lair?

Although their intellects were great, their sort actually had rather simple desires, which naturally reflected on the décor of their living environment.

First, the gigantic green-scaled monster reached into its [Astral Pocket], and began taking out its favorite arcane lighting. Great gleaming orbs which emanated light in a dazzling array of colors were spread out all around the cavern, where they floated in midair, like suspended droplets of water.

Next, the dragon looked to the corners of the room, and inhaled—then breathed out. Fire. A great cone of Dragonfire was sent at the corners of the room, and the dragon spun languidly around in a circle, dragging the ray of fire with it, covering each and every corner.

Dust was burned off, and eternally burning Dragonfire was left behind in flickering patches, giving the room a distinctive background tapestry.

So, the walls and ceiling were handled, and all that remained was the floor space. Giant red eyes focused on the stone, calculating its optimum placement relative to the other things. Once more, the dragon reached into its [Astral Pocket], this time opening it wide, facing the room.

And an avalanche of gold spilled out.

Coins, golden coins of all shapes and sizes, with the stamps of a hundred kingdoms on them spread out to cover every inch of the floor. The dragon reached out with its great muscled tail, and lifted up the stone, setting it up at the very top of the golden mountain.

And then it looked over its small kingdom, satisfied.

For it was time to engage in the favorite pastime of dragons. In a way, it was kin to stone. For they both had a shared patience born of immortality.

The dragon curled in place, around the mountain of gold, and fell asleep.

And the rock looked out at its new sleeping roommate, on its new perch atop a mountain of gold. The rock was beginning to understand the cycles of the world. Even if it proceeded steadily down a mountain, it might eventually end up on top of a brand new one. Such is the way of the world, where those who reach for immortality and power will always find a new peak of Mt. Tai beyond the last one.

But the stone was not dismayed. So what of peaks? As long as it could level and grow stronger, the world was its oyster. Or quarry. Maybe it would like something like that more. And regarding its next leveling plan… The dragon fire at the edges of the room was steadily heating it up. It could feasibly move just a bit.

It ran some calculations in its mind. Could it launch itself out at the dragon, aimed precisely at the head, and then crush it?

Just imagine the experience gains from that…

But a faint sense of danger held the stone in place. It was learning, and though the dragon seemed to be sleeping, there was a trace of awareness there, in the tail that swished about as it slept.

Attacking it would be… risky.

Picking up the rock had been so easy for the muscled tail, the rock did not doubt it could be crushed in an instant. Or be put inside that terrifying [Astral Pocket].

However, the rock also noticed something else. The material all around it—this so-called “gold”… It had heard the term before. Where was it? The rock looked over at its stat sheet.
